      <title>my experience with my 1999 911 porsche -  unlocking the hood</title>
      <link>http://answers.edmunds.com/question-my-experience-1999-911-porsche-unlocking-hood-4622.aspx</link>
      <description>hi mr shiftright .  the option of the red fuse to find boost to the battery was not available until 2002  .    the lighter to lighter did not work  for me  .. i did find the emergency hood cable . which is located around the back of the passenger headlight .  one must take the plastic liner off and feel and feel believe me it is there.  it is there ; than give the battery a normal battery cable jump.  hope this helps someone else AJL</description>
